Welcome to our fossil sorting data exploration page! This is where you can discover insights and statistics about our fossil sorting sessions. Here you'll find data visualizations, trends, and analysis related to our microfossil sorting efforts and the contributions of our dedicated volunteers.

About This Data

This page showcases data collected from our fossil sorting sessions, including participation statistics, fossil discovery rates, and other metrics that help us understand the impact and progress of our research activities. The data helps us track our contributions to paleontological research and recognize the valuable work of our volunteers.
